8 Artery-Cleansing Foods You Should Be Eating Every Day for a Healthy Heart

Your heart works tirelessly, pumping blood and delivering oxygen throughout your body. But when your arteries get clogged with plaque from poor diet and lifestyle habits, that smooth flow is disrupted—raising your risk of heart disease, stroke, and even sudden cardiac events. The good news? What you put on your plate can help protect your arteries and keep your cardiovascular system strong. Let’s explore eight artery-cleansing foods you should be eating daily for a healthier heart.

Why Artery Health Matters

Arteries are like highways for your blood. When they’re clear, blood flows freely. But when they’re blocked by cholesterol, fat, or calcium deposits, traffic slows down—sometimes to a dangerous stop. Over time, this buildup (atherosclerosis) can lead to heart attacks or strokes. Eating artery-friendly foods is like sending in a cleaning crew every day to sweep away the junk and keep circulation moving smoothly.

1. Oats: Nature’s Cholesterol Sponge

A warm bowl of oats is more than a comforting breakfast—it’s a heart saver. Oats are packed with soluble fiber, particularly beta-glucan, which acts like a sponge in your digestive tract. It binds to cholesterol and helps flush it out before it can stick to your arteries. Start your day with oatmeal topped with berries and nuts for a double dose of artery-cleansing power.

2. Fatty Fish: Omega-3 Powerhouses

Salmon, mackerel, sardines, and tuna are rich in omega-3 fatty acids—fats that actually protect your heart instead of harm it. Omega-3s lower triglycerides, reduce inflammation, and prevent blood clots, all of which keep your arteries flexible and clear. Aim for two servings of fatty fish per week, or try plant-based omega-3 sources like chia seeds and flaxseeds if you don’t eat fish.

3. Leafy Greens: Nature’s Artery Armor

Spinach, kale, Swiss chard, and collard greens are loaded with nitrates, which help widen blood vessels and improve circulation. They’re also rich in fiber, antioxidants, and vitamin K, which prevents calcium buildup in arteries. Adding a salad or green smoothie to your daily routine is one of the simplest ways to protect your arteries.

Video : Top Artery-Cleansing Foods You Should Eat Daily (Backed by Science)

4. Berries: Antioxidant Superstars

Blueberries, strawberries, raspberries, and blackberries aren’t just sweet—they’re artery defenders. Berries contain anthocyanins, antioxidants that reduce oxidative stress and inflammation, both of which play major roles in plaque buildup. A handful of berries a day can improve blood pressure and keep arteries supple.

5. Nuts and Seeds: Tiny but Mighty Protectors

Almonds, walnuts, pistachios, flaxseeds, and chia seeds are nutrient-dense foods that support heart health. Packed with healthy fats, magnesium, and fiber, they reduce LDL cholesterol (the bad kind) while boosting HDL cholesterol (the good kind). Just a small handful daily can help keep your arteries in top shape.

6. Avocados: Creamy Heart Helpers

Avocados are rich in monounsaturated fats, which lower bad cholesterol while raising good cholesterol levels. They also provide potassium, an essential mineral that helps regulate blood pressure. Swap out mayonnaise or butter for avocado slices on toast or in sandwiches for a heart-smart upgrade.

7. Garlic: The Natural Blood Flow Booster

Garlic has been used for centuries as a natural remedy, and science backs up its heart benefits. Compounds in garlic, particularly allicin, help lower cholesterol, reduce blood pressure, and keep blood vessels flexible. Adding fresh garlic to your cooking is an easy way to give your arteries extra protection.

8. Olive Oil: Liquid Gold for the Heart

Extra virgin olive oil is a staple of the Mediterranean diet, known for reducing heart disease risk. Its healthy monounsaturated fats and powerful antioxidants lower inflammation and protect arterial walls. Drizzle it on salads, roasted vegetables, or use it as a dip for whole-grain bread instead of processed oils or butter.

Lifestyle Choices That Complement Artery-Cleansing Foods

While these foods are powerful, they work best when paired with healthy lifestyle choices:

  • Stay physically active with at least 30 minutes of movement daily.
  • Avoid smoking and limit alcohol.
  • Reduce processed foods, sugar, and trans fats that clog arteries.
  • Manage stress through relaxation, mindfulness, or hobbies.

Video : The TOP FOODS to Clean Arteries & PREVENT HEART DISEASE! I Dr. William Li

Conclusion

Your arteries are vital lifelines, and the choices you make every day directly affect their health. By eating foods like oats, fatty fish, leafy greens, berries, nuts, avocados, garlic, and olive oil, you’re not just filling your plate—you’re actively protecting your heart. Think of these foods as daily armor against heart disease, keeping your arteries clear and your body energized. Small, consistent changes to your diet can lead to a stronger heart and a longer, healthier life.

Related Posts